We are looking to hire a positive, proactive IT project manager to oversee project teams and to ensure IT projects are completed on time. The IT project manager will establish a Project Management Office (PMO), and direct and coordinate the utilization of resources across divisions of the project to reach targets. The IT project manager will ensure compliance with budget and other project requirements. You will document instructions for end-users and assist with the testing of the final product. You will communicate with stakeholders during all phases of the project, and close it efficiently.
To be successful in this role you should deliver an extensively recorded, tested, intact, and operative product within delivery time frames and budget. Ideal candidates will be analytical and have a positive demeanor.
IT Project Manager Responsibilities:
- Assisting in establishing a Project Management Office to oversee multiple projects.
- Liaising with stakeholders such as project personnel, vendors, and end-users regarding project requirements.
- Outlining, defining, and initiating the project.
- Implementing document control policies and documentation templates.
- Maintaining a good working knowledge of assigned component projects.
- Evaluating standards of component products.
- Monitoring project progress and implementing changes where necessary.
- Monitoring expenditures in accordance with the budget.
- Ensuring compliance with objectives, organizational policies, procedures, and standards.
- Compiling project reports and informing management regarding problems.
- Ensuring project complies with best practices, SOPs, PMO policies, and other policies.
